INTERMOLECULAR INTERACTIONS IN ORGANIC LIQUID MIXTURES: THERMODYNAMIC AND ACOUSTIC PERSPECTIVES

Sudha D/O Chandrakant, Dr. Neeraj Panwar

By : Laxmi Book Publication

Abstract :

The study explores intermolecular interactions in organic liquid mixtures through thermodynamic and acoustic analyses. Experimental measurements of density, viscosity, refractive index, and ultrasonic velocity were performed over a range of temperatures and compositions for selected binary organic mixtures.
